Output 73677c1dbd121fccd923b0a22b1526d52514f1beb6624617c5d7ab7c4fe1581a: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5156d5efba13c52d6cc5afbc806f36662579978 OP_EQUAL
address
3NaJLGCzCnzR1pXAAsNXWxvNGoJ4TPRXeN
transaction
73677c1dbd121fccd923b0a22b1526d52514f1beb6624617c5d7ab7c4fe1581a
spent
true